Output cc291877dee431d5f229ce156bf8eeac0f13dd411cb2c631a20d37bc4440f764:72

value
3998947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31e04fec39b45c6bc8a7106626a539b57d38c2eb OP_EQUAL
address
36EjkRnktLQAc6snk36jYqoUs74DWbXt53
transaction
cc291877dee431d5f229ce156bf8eeac0f13dd411cb2c631a20d37bc4440f764
confirmations
173456
spent
true